Airports in Toronto
Toronto Pearson International Airport (YYZ)
Travelling from central Toronto to YYZ takes around 25 minutes by public transport. If you drive, ride-share or grab a taxi, you'll cover the 27 kilometres in 30 minutes or so, depending on traffic.

Billy Bishop Toronto City Airport (YTZ)
Using public transport, you can travel from central Toronto to YTZ in around 20 minutes. The airport is roughly 3 kilometres away, and making the trip by car will take approximately 10 minutes.

John C. Munro Hamilton International Airport (YHM)
YHM is roughly 72 kilometres from central Toronto. The drive from the city centre to the airport takes about 1 hour 10 minutes. If you're planning to take public transport, expect a journey of around 1 hour 50 minutes.

Getting from Alexander Kartveli Batumi Intl Airport (BUS) to central Batumi
Alexander Kartveli Batumi Intl Airport to central Batumi is around 5 kilometres. If you're renting a car or taking a taxi, plan ahead to make your trip as smooth as possible. Journey times may vary depending on traffic conditions and the time of day.
Travelling on public transport will take you around 15 minutes.

The best time to fly from Toronto to Alexander Kartveli Batumi Intl Airport (BUS)
October is when most people book flights from Toronto to Alexander Kartveli Batumi Intl Airport (BUS). Plan your visit to Batumi in April for a more low-key escape.
The warmest month in Batumi is August, with temperatures ranging between 16ºC and 30ºC. Book your Toronto to BUS plane ticket then if this is the type of weather you enjoy.
If you like travelling in cooler conditions, look for a cheap ticket from Toronto to Alexander Kartveli Batumi Intl Airport in January when temperatures are between 0ºC and 12ºC.
